Bangalore: Health Kalon Choekyong Wangchuk discussed health preventive and treatment in terms of open gyms, W.A.S.H. (water and sanitation hygiene), playgrounds, as well as the Tibetan Medicare System (TMS) to the Tibetans of Hunsur community on 11 October. Furthermore, he elaborated on the four resolutions of the recently concluded Third General Special Meeting.
The Health Kalon continued his Hunsur trip by visiting the local the Tibetan Medical and Astrological Institute (Mentseekhang) branch, public health centers under the Department of Health, and the local Sambhota school. In addition, he went to see the construction of elephant trenches of the settlement.
The following day, Kalon Choekyong Wangchuk visited the Higher Power Foundation in Bangalore and also met the patients under the substance abuse de-addiction center.
The Higher Power Foundation is one of the highest-rated rehabilitation centers in Bangalore and provides a comfortable residential facility for the treatment of alcoholism and drug addiction. They aid people in changing their lives and live a sober life by giving quality treatment in a secure, calm and healthy environment.
Thereafter Kalon met with Tibetan students and addressed them.
